LED CONVERTER

SMART-300W

300W Single Output Switching Power Supply
Feature
  • 1. 200~240VAC input only
  • 2. Fully encapsulated with IP68 level (Note. 5)
  • 3. Protections : Short circuit/Overload/Over voltage. Over Temperature
  • 4. Cooling by free air convection
  • 5. Class I power unit
  • 6. Suitable for LED lighting and moving sign applications
  • 7. High reliability / Low cost
  • 8. Built - C.V. Mode
Specifications
Output DC Voltage DC 12V
Rated Current 23A
Current Range 0-23A
Rated Power 276W
Efficiency 93.50%
Voltage Tolerance Note.3 ±0.5V
Line Regulation ±1.0%
Load Regulation ±2.0%
Setup, Rise Time 1500ms, 30ms/220VAC
Hold Up Time (Typ) 20ms/220VAC at full load
Input Voltage Range /
No Load Power
200-240VAC / < 0.67W
Frequency Range 50 ~ 60Hz
Power Factor > 0.5
AC Current 2.6A(MAX)
Inrush Current (Typ.) Cold Start 30A (width = 200 ㎲ measured at 50% Ipeak ) at 220VAC
Protection Over Load Above 105% rated output power
Protection type : Hiccup mode, recovers automatically after fault condition is removed
Over Voltage Protection type : Shut off o/p voltage, clamping by zener diode
Over Temperature Shut down, recovers automatically after temperature goes down
Enviroment Working Temperature -20~+50℃ (Refer to "Derating Curve")
Working Humidity 20~90% RH non-condensing
Storage Temperature. Humidity -40~+80℃, 10~95% RH
Temperature. Coefficient ±0.03%/℃ (0~50℃)
Vibration 10~500Hz, 2g 10min./1cycle, period for 60min. each along X,Y,Z axes.
Safety & EMC Safety Standards IP68 . KC
Withstand Voltage I/P-O/P : 3.75KVAC
Isolation Resistance I/P-O/P : 100M Ohms/ 500VDC/ 25 ℃℃/ 70% RH
Others Dimension 210 x 63.5 x 42mmH
Weight 690g
Note 1. All parameters NOT specially mentioned are measured all 220VAC input, rated load and 25°C of ambient temperature.
2. Ripple & noise are measured at 20MHz of bandwidth by using a 12" twisted pair wire terminated with a 0.1uF & 47uF parallel capacitor.
3. Tolerance : includes set up tolerance, line regulation and load regulation.
4. Suitable for indoor use or outdoor use without direct sunlight exposure.
